From Ottoman Turkish قورندی (ḳurundu, ḳuruntu, “any wild fancy taken into the head”), from Ottoman Turkish قورمق (ḳurmaḳ, “to establish, to organize, to set, to form, to take strange mad fancies into one's head”), from Proto-Turkic *kur- (“to set up, to draw (a bowstring)”), morphologically kur- + -un + -tu.
